MEMO — Kettling Depot Receiving

Uniform sets for the new Kettling depot arrive Wednesday via Ashgrove courier: 40 boxes, sorted by size, manifest attached to box one. Check the count at the dock before signing; shortages go straight to stores, not the courier. The hand-over instruction the courier will follow is set out below.

drop instructions, tafof-baguf: the holmir gilox courier leaves the sormir ulaok holdor ledger at gate 5596 under passcode 257343

Handover for new starters at Thimbleforge Labs: the prototype workshop on the ground floor houses the resin printers, the CNC bench, and all test rigs for the Quellan project. Safety glasses are mandatory and live in the rack by the door — please sign them back in after use. Nothing leaves the room without a log entry. The door code is below.

badge for fafop-fajof: bdg-Z-47

**Ticket #— Facilities: Contractor first week, Larkspur site**

Contractor starts Monday, fitting ductwork on Level 2. Temporary pass issued for five days; surrender it at the front desk each evening. No solo access to plant rooms. Parking is off-site only. Report to the Larkspur facilities hatch by 08:00 daily. For the contractor entrance keypad, use the code below.

turnstile pass: bdg-QZV-3

Facilities ticket — Night shift, Brindlecote Campus. Twenty-two interns from the Fennhollow programme arrive tomorrow at 08:00. Please unlock seminar rooms B2 and B3 by 06:30, set chairs to classroom layout, and confirm the water coolers on level one are refilled. Leave the loading bay clear for their equipment van. Overnight access to the prep corridor requires the pass code below.

badge for bajop-yawep: bdg-NNHEW-6

# Millbrook Schema Migrator — zero-downtime configuration
# Plugin authors: this file drives the dual-write phase of our
# zero-downtime migration flow. Your plugin's migrations are applied
# to the shadow schema first, verified, then promoted without locking
# live tables. Do not change the batch or timeout settings below
# without coordinating with the platform team. The migrator must
# authenticate to the shadow database before any promotion runs, and
# that credential is set on the very next line.

sealed setting: ARCHIVE_KEY3=8d0